Conference on "Water Diplomacy: Building Bridges for Lasting Peace"

logo-geneva-peace-week.pngConference on "Water Diplomacy: Building Bridges for Lasting Peace"

Friday 9 November 2018, 9:30 to 16:00
World Meteorological Organisation (WMO)
Kruzel Hall
Avenue de la Paix 7bis, Geneva. ()

The Geneva Water Hub’s Platform for International Water Law is pleased to invite you to a Conference on « Water Diplomacy: Building Bridges for Lasting Peace ». This event is taking place in the context of the .

The Conference will cover the multiple challenges of the nexus between water, peace and security both from the science, legal and governance standpoint. It includes two segments:

  1. Threatened critical water infrastructure and peacebuilding;

  2. Transboundary water cooperation, local governance mechanisms and water diplomacy.

The objectives of the Conference are twofold:

  1. To discuss the opportunities of water as a resource for peacebuilding;

  2. To address good practices of water management mechanisms to prevent tensions at the local and international levels;

The event organizers include The Geneva Water Hub/AV¶ÌÊÓÆµ, UN Environment, GeoExpertise - Graduate Institute of International and Development Studies and Rally for Rivers.
